How Does the US Income Tax Calculator Work?

The US Income Tax Calculator uses the IRS’s progressive tax brackets and your financial details to determine your estimated tax.
It factors in:us-incom

  • Filing status (Single, Married Filing Jointly, etc.)
  • Gross income
  • Standard or itemized deductions
  • Tax credits
  • Withholdings

Example:
If you are single, earn $70,000, and take the standard deduction of $14,600 (2025 rate), your taxable income is $55,400. Using IRS tax brackets, your estimated tax is around $8,700 before credits.

Filing StatusStandard Deduction (2025)
Single$14,600
Married Filing Jointly$29,200
Head of Household$21,900

What Are the 2025 US Federal Income Tax Brackets?

Tax RateSingleMarried Filing Jointly
10%$0 – $11,600$0 – $23,200
12%$11,601 – $47,150$23,201 – $94,300
22%$47,151 – $100,525$94,301 – $201,050
24%$100,526 – $191,950$201,051 – $383,900
32%$191,951 – $243,725$383,901 – $487,450
35%$243,726 – $609,350$487,451 – $731,200
37%$609,351+$731,201+
